Ukraine, maritime contracts, and when war is not a war

On 9 March, Seatrade Maritime News reported that Russia’s invasion of Ukraine and its ongoing military actions in Ukraine are acts of war as a matter of English law, according to a prominent maritime lawyer, but that does not mean that war termination clauses will necessarily trigger.
